Istanbul, the cultural and economic heart of Turkey, bridges the gap between Europe and Asia. With its historic landmarks like the Hagia Sophia and Topkapi Palace, lively bazaars, and the scenic Bosphorus, Istanbul offers a unique blend of ancient charm and modern vibrancy.
Cappadocia is a unique region known for its surreal landscapes of fairy-tale chimneys and cave dwellings. Visitors can take hot air balloon rides over the scenic valleys, explore ancient underground cities, and appreciate the distinctive rock formations that make this region truly magical
Antalya, located on the stunning Turkish Riviera, is a coastal paradise with a blend of ancient history and modern luxury. The city boasts Roman-era landmarks, a picturesque old town (Kaleiçi), and beautiful beaches, making it a popular destination for both history enthusiasts and sun-seekers
Pamukkale is famous for its surreal terraces of white travertine, created by mineral-rich thermal waters. The ancient city of Hierapolis, with its well-preserved ruins and the Cleopatra Pool, adds to the allure of this UNESCO World Heritage Site
Nestled at the foot of Mount Uludağ, Bursa is known for its historical significance as the first capital of the Ottoman Empire. The city showcases Ottoman architecture, including the Grand Mosque and the Green Tomb. Visitors also enjoy the scenic beauty of Uludağ National Park.
Soğut is a tranquil town with historical importance, known as the birthplace of the founder of the Ottoman Empire, Osman Gazi. Visitors can explore historical sites like the tomb of Osman Gazi and experience the serene rural atmosphere.
Sapanca, surrounded by lush greenery and the calming Sapanca Lake, offers a peaceful retreat. The town is known for its natural beauty, outdoor activities, and the refreshing Sapanca Lake. It's a popular destination for those seeking relaxation and a break from the city hustle
